A pithy critique on society's commercialization and commodification of water,
its end goals abetted by an utter disregard for the future, both near or far.
The film is a mixed media whirlwind of hyperactive animated collage. It was
made for Hothouse 1, the NFB’s program for emerging filmmakers, whose central
theme was “Water and Our Relationship to It.”.
